Bay Region 4 CPIN with City College of San Francisco and Children's Coucil of San Francisco are pleased to bring "Ready...Set...Go!": Engaging Early Learners in Physical Science. If you are a preschool or transitional teacher or administrator this module is for you! We will explore how children learn about cause and effect, the physical properties of objects and materials, and changes in objects and materials while engaging in project-based activities to take back to the classroom. You will become familiar with the structure and features of the Foundations and Framework, Volume 3 Science Domain's Physical Science Strand. We'll also learn about integration opportunities between Volumes 1,2, and 3 of the Foundations, as well as, authentic research-based strategies that support learning for all children.
